Now the only way you could have missed this is if you are living under a rock-the ousting of General Stanley McChrytal. Gen. McChrystal provided the President of the United States with his letter of resignation after an interview he had with Rolling Stone and made disparaging comments regarding civilian leaders regarding the current War on Terror, amongst other uncomplimentary comments. So, President Obama, being the man that he is, requested the general’s presence in DC, and less than 48 hours later, the world heard of General McChrystal’s resignation, much to the delight of both Republicans, who didn’t think the President would do anything, and Democrats. As General McChrystal is heading out the door, in comes General David Petraeus to take over our armed forces in the Middle East. I don’t think General Petraeus will have a problem getting confirmed next week as both parties support him in this new position.
